#a91166 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a91166 is composed of 66.3% red, 6.7%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.9% magenta, 39.6%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 326.4 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 36.5%. #a91166 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ff22cc with #530000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#a91166 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a91166 has RGB values of R:169, G:17,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.4,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 11080038.

Shades and Tints of #a91166
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090105 is the darkest color, while #fef6fa is the lightest one.
